Acquaint Your Child With the Dental Workplace
Start by taking your youngster to the oral office prior to their initial visit, so they can end up being familiar with the surroundings and really feel more secure. This step is critical in helping to minimize any anxiousness or fear your child might have regarding mosting likely to the dentist.
Below are a couple of ways to familiarize your kid with the dental workplace:
- ** Schedule a quick excursion **: Call the oral workplace and ask if you can bring your child for a brief scenic tour. This will enable them to see the waiting area, treatment areas, and meet the pleasant team.
- ** Role-play in the house **: Pretend to be the dental expert and have your kid sit in a chair while you analyze their teeth. This will certainly help them comprehend what to anticipate throughout their actual see.
- ** Review publications or see video clips **: Seek kids's books or videos that describe what occurs at the dental professional. This can help your child really feel extra comfortable and prepared.
